The Global Through Hole Passive Components Market will grow from USD 37.29 Billion in 2025 to USD 62.13 Billion by 2031 at a 8.88% CAGR. Through-hole passive components are electronic elements such as resistors, capacitors, and inductors that feature leads designed to be inserted through drilled holes in a printed circuit board and soldered to establish a connection.

Key Market Drivers
The rising demand for high-reliability automotive electronics and EV powertrains acts as a primary catalyst for the adoption of through-hole passive components. As manufacturers transition toward electrification, the requirement for components enduring thermal cycling and high-voltage loads becomes critical. Through-hole resistors and capacitors are integrated into inverters because their leaded architecture provides robust mechanical anchorage against vibrations.
Key Market Challenges
The rapid industry-wide transition toward Surface Mount Technology represents the primary impediment to the expansion of the Global Through Hole Passive Components Market. This shift is fundamentally driven by the relentless demand for miniaturization and the necessity to optimize component density on printed circuit boards. Surface mount counterparts offer superior compatibility with high-speed automated assembly systems, significantly reducing manufacturing costs compared to the manual or semi-automated insertion processes required for through-hole leads.
Key Market Trends
The advancement of automated robotic insertion and AI-driven manufacturing is fundamentally reshaping the production landscape for through-hole passive components. Manufacturers are increasingly deploying advanced insertion machines that eliminate the traditional reliance on manual labor, thereby neutralizing the cost disparities between through-hole and surface mount assembly. This transition is critical for maintaining the viability of leaded resistors and capacitors in mass-production environments where precision and speed are paramount.
